Continue ReadingLots of big swings took place on Saturday and the pin hitters looked really good. The setters ran a well oiled machine and made their hitters look really good! During a showcase sometimes it can be hard to create chemistry and temp with hitters, but these setters did an excellent job of distributing the ball across the pins and making some really smart decisions. Here is a look at some of the tall and talented setters that stood out at the Stock Up Showcase.
Let’s start out with Class of 2027 5’10” setter Ellery DeBoer out of Willmar High School and plays club for Kandi Elite . She runs a quick tempo ball and has strong hands. DeBoer jumps set really well for a freshman. She did a fantastic job of disturbing the ball across the net and keeping blockers off balance. Ellery really started to develop some good chemistry on the court with her hitters too. Take note of this fresh face!

5’10” setter Savy Repinski Savy Repinski 5'10" | S Cotter | 2026 State MN out of Cotter High School and plays club for Elevate VBC. She’s a lefty and is an offensive threat at the net. She had 80 kills last fall for the Ramblers. Being a lefty she is able to take an overpass and put it down and also has a great two handed setter dump. She is dynamic in the front row being a dual threat to set or put the ball on the opposite floor. Repinski had 610 assists, and 66 ace serves in her freshman campaign. Keep this offensive minded setter on your radar!
5’10” setter Izzy Reichert Izzy Reichert 5'11" | S Eau Claire Regis | 2026 WI out of Regis High School and plays club for Kokoro 16-1 has great hands, hustles all over the floor and really keeps the offense humming. She also celebrates her teammates and is a great floor leader. I really love her ability to extend plays with her hustle.
Class of 2024’s
6’0” setter Katie Brandl Katie Brandl 6'0" | S Forest Lake | 2024 State MN out of Forest Lake and plays club for Kokoros Volleyball has great hands. She runs a fast tempo and is really quick. Brandl also squares to her hitters well, especially on the pins. For the Rangers last fall she had 886 set assists, 38 kills, 38 aces and 164 digs. Look for her to have a standout senior season!
5’6” setter/defensive specialist Abby Distad Abby Distad 5'6" | S Kasson-Mantorville | 2024 State MN out of Kasson Mantorville High School and plays club for KVBC does a phenomenal job of playing outside to in defense to collapse on those hard cross court shots. She is so strong with her sets and can push it pin to pin with ease. Distad sets just a really nice ball to her hitters. She extends play with her defense and can catch offenses off guard with her sets. Last fall she had 905 set assists, 256 digs and chipped in 65 ace serves. She is a jack of all trades kind of player that keeps plays going and is also a huge encouragement to her teammates on the floor!
5’9” setter Mya Smith Mya Smith 5'9" | S St. Michael Albertville | 2024 State MN out of St. Michael/Albertsville and plays club for Crossfire has a fantastic deep float serve that is hard to handle for receivers. She also plays great floor defense and has soft hands. She had an amazing back set from about left front to the right pin for the opposite to get a kill because the blockers were stunned. Her passion and enthusiasm are contagious too! Take note!
